Bladex’s fundamentals remain strong, with 9M25 net profit up 11% year over year to $170.9 million, ROE still robust at 16.2%, and the credit portfolio reaching a new high of $12.3 billion. Financial health is solid, supported by very low impaired credits at 0.2% of portfolio, 5.4x reserve coverage, 15.5% liquidity-to-assets, and improved capital ratios after the AT1 issuance. The main offset is growth quality pressure from declining net interest margin and higher credit-loss provisions as the loan book expands.
